"The Great East Japan Earthquake: How Art Can Find Its Own Way"(English only)
What is the role of art after a catastrophic event? Confronting the enormous power of nature unleashed by the 3/11 earthquake and tsunami, many Japanese artists and art professionals felt powerless. Yet, we are uplifted by a comment made by a 16-year-old boy, rescued nine days after the earthquake. Asked what he wanted to be in the future, he answered: "I want to be an artist."
On 11 June, exactly three months after the 3/11 Great East Japan Earthquake, the exhibition "Remembrance of the Future to Come" opens to face this disaster from the viewpoint of five artists.
12 June 2011 (Sun) 11:00--13:00
Speakers: Ingo Günther, Shinji Ohmaki, Koh Sato, Shinya Watanabe
In the part of the Exhibition: "Remembrance of the Future to Come"
Location: Former "Plug.in" (Sankt-Alban Rheinweg 64, 4052 Basel, Switzerland)
